Branch managers: warranty claims on the Durapress 400 line exceeded the annual provision by 31% as of last quarter. The overrun traces mainly to a gasket defect in units assembled at the Kelverton plant between March and June. Corbyn Manufacturing has issued a field-repair kit, and claim turnaround is now averaging nine days. Branches should log all repairs through the standard portal and avoid goodwill replacements without regional sign-off. Strategic implications for the product line are summarized in the confidential note that follows.

internal memo for hahif-hahaf: Headcount on the Zorwyn team goes from 9 to 100 by the end of October. Gross margin on Zorwyn came in at 5 percent against a plan of 10 percent.

## Local Setup

Bouncebox processes bounce webhooks from the Merletto mail relay and files them into a Postgres table your plugin can query. Clone the repo, run `make deps`, and start the worker with `./bouncebox serve --dev`. It'll spin up a fake SMTP feed so you get sample bounces right away. Before starting, point the worker at your local database with the connection string below.

database URL for tajog-bajeg: mysql://soreth_svc:OzsCjhu@db-6997.nelvrostack.internal:5432/kelax

Hey, thanks for taking on the security review of Matchwell, our order-matching service. The thing you'll hear about constantly is GC pauses: the matcher runs on a tuned JVM, and anything over 40ms shows up as missed fills. Pause telemetry streams into the Pausewatch dashboard, which is where most of our evidence lives. To pull raw pause traces from the Pausewatch API during your review, you'll want the key below.

gateway credential: kto23_LX9A4ys6i4nzHtpOLNLodKK